Shopping

In Kashiwa, enjoy the vibrant Mallage Kashiwa, a hub for shopping, entertainment, and family activities. If you're up for a drive, LaLaport, located 19.3km away, and Mitsui Outlet Park Makuhari, 24.1km away, both offer extensive shopping options and lively atmospheres.

Recreation

Experience the energetic atmosphere at ZOZO Marine Stadium, perfect for sports enthusiasts. For a serene escape, unwind at Akebonoyama Park, where you can enjoy the calming environment. Alternatively, visit Funabashi Andersen Park for leisurely strolls amidst beautiful landscapes, promoting relaxation and wellness.

Adventure

The Arimino Course offers an exhilarating zipline ropes course experience set amidst nature's beauty, located 9.7km from Kashiwa. For a splash of fun, visit Shirakobato Water Park, 22.5km away, where families can enjoy thrilling water rides. Alternatively, hit the slopes at Kamui Ryugasaki Snowboard Park, 20.9km from Kashiwa.

Nightlife

Kashiwa's nightlife offers a captivating blend of experiences. Enjoy a performance at Suzumoto Theater for a cultural evening. Alternatively, explore the stars at Konica Minolta Planetarium Tenku, perfect for family entertainment, or take a spin on the Diamond and Flower Ferris Wheel for a thrilling adventure.

Best time to go to Kashiwa

The best time to visit Kashiwa is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February42.3°F (5.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March49.5°F (9.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
April57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
May66.4°F (19.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June72.0°F (22.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July79.3°F (26.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August81.7°F (27.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September75.2°F (24.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October65.1°F (18.4°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Kashiwa

Accessing Kashiwa, Chiba Prefecture, is convenient via three major airports. Haneda Airport (HND), situated 38.6km away, offers excellent hotel options such as The Prince Park Tower Tokyo and The Capitol Hotel Tokyu, both approximately 8 to 14.5km from the airport, with shuttle services available. Narita International Airport (NRT), located 37.0km from Kashiwa, features nearby hotels like Hotel Nikko Narita and Hilton Tokyo Narita Airport, both within 3.2km. Ibaraki Airport (IBR) is 33.2km away, with options like Hotel Route Inn Ishioka, about 11.3km from the airport. Each airport provides accessible transportation services to ensure a smooth journey to Kashiwa.

What is there to see in Kashiwa?
Landmarks like Old Yoshida House Residential Historical Park and Hirohatahachimangu might be worth a visit. Natural beauty is on display at Kashiwanoha Park, Lake Teganuma and Erythronium Ground. How can I get around Kashiwa?
Nearby metro stations include Kashiwanoha-campus Station and Kashiwa-Tanaka Station. If you want to see more of the area, take a train from Kita-kashiwa Station, Kashiwa Station or Chiba Shin-Kashiwa Station. What's the seasonal weather like in Kashiwa?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. The rainiest months in Kashiwa are October, September, June and July, with each month seeing an average of 185 mm of rainfall.
